- Summary
- Various statistical computing formulas have been used to estimate the transfer of radionuclides from one environmental component to another. The parameter being estimated is the ratio ..mu../sub V//..mu../sub U/, where ..mu../sub U/ is the true mean concentration of the donor component (e.g., soil), and ..mu../sub V/ is the true mean concentration of the receiving component (e.g., vegetation). In radionuclide research ..mu../sub V//..mu../sub U/ may be the concentration ratio (CR) or the inventory ratio (IR). A Monte Carlo computer simulation study in conjunction with mathematical derivations of bias and root expected mean square was conducted to provide guidance on which of eight estimators (computing formulae) are most likely to give the best estimate of ..mu../sub V//..mu../sub U/. These estimators were evaluated for both laboratory and field studies when data are normally or lognormally distributed.
